Oklahoma Code § 17-502

Title 17. Corporation Commission: Definitions
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
As used in this act:
1.  "Commission" shall mean the Corporation Commission of
Oklahoma;
2.  "Person" shall include any individual, partnership,
corporation or association of whatever character;
3.  "Common source of supply" shall include that area which is
underlain, or which from geological or other scientific data, or
from drilling operations, or other evidence, appears to be underlain
by a common accumulation of brine; provided, that, if any such area
is underlain or appears from geologic or other scientific data, or
from drilling operations, or from other evidence to be underlain by
more than one common accumulation of brine separated from each other
by a strata of earth and not connected with each other, then such
area, as to each said common accumulation of brine, shall be deemed
a separate common source of supply;
4.  "Brine" shall mean subterranean saltwater and all of its
constituent parts and chemical substances therein contained,
including, but not limited to bromine, magnesium, potassium,
lithium, boron, chlorine, iodine, calcium, strontium, sodium,
sulphur, barium or other chemical substances produced with or
separated from such saltwater.  Brine produced as an incident to the
production of oil or gas, unless such brine is saved or sold for the
purposes of removing chemical substances therefrom, shall not be
considered brine for the purposes of this act.  Gas, whether found
in solution or otherwise, shall not be included within the meaning
of the term "brine";
5.  "Brine owner" shall mean any person entitled to share in the
proceeds from the sale of brine production;
6.  "Solution gas" shall mean all gas produced from brine wells
from the brine common source of supply within the unit area;
7.  "Solution gas owner" shall mean any person entitled to share
in the proceeds from the sale of solution gas;
8.  "Owner" or "owners", unless a more specific term is used,
shall mean any person or entity who qualifies as either a brine
owner or a solution gas owner;
9.  "Operator" shall mean a person who has the right to drill
into and produce from any brine common source of supply and to
appropriate that production, either for himself, or for himself and
others, and is authorized by the Commission to drill;
10.  "Effluent" shall mean the liquid remaining after extraction
of the chemical substances from brine;
11.  "Brine production unit" or "unit" shall mean each separate
specific area of land so designated by order of the Commission for

production of brine and associated solution gas and the injection of
effluent;
12.  "Injection well" shall mean a well authorized by the
Commission for the injection of effluent or other solutions; and
13.  "Manufacture" shall mean the complete process of drilling,
completing, equipping and operating production and injection wells
and of extracting and packaging brine.
